Squirrel Industries has stepped up its game with the inclusion of a new type of Squirrel Industries produced Vehicle.

The Master Class Vehicle (MCV).

Background

Squirrel Industries MCVs are a common vehicle platform that has been extensively modified for different purposes. The TS-14 project originally started out through the TS-10 project. Squirrel Industries set out to create a dual gun tank, with extreme off-road capability and plenty of defensive measures in place to protect it.


TS-10 Pictured during trials at Maywar

However, the program got cancelled in favour of the TS-11 project due to the proposed higher versatility and fire power at its disposal. However, the TS-11 was also cancelled after issues with added weight from the second turret meaning the off-road capabilities of the TS-11 were compromised as well as this, the hull proved to be too tall and consequently countermeasure coverage was poor.


TS-11 Undergoing operational testing at Wright

Development

Much later, Squirrel Industries began investigating the possibility of an armoured repair vehicle to aid forces that would otherwise in incapable of being reached to adequately repair vehicles. Although, after much design work to create a low-profile hull, it became apparent that the TS-14 at the time (later named Apollo) had a lot more potential as a multi-platform vehicle.

Learning from previous errors in tank design, Squirrel Industries decided to draft up 2 tank models (later known as Ares and Athena), to serve 2 different purposes. A Peace Support Operation (PSO) fit, which would serve as a heavily armed brute force battle tank and a Scout fit, used for more strategic operations which required more speed, agility and a wider range of tactical weapons.

The TS-14 project's scope was widened once more when the need for a bridge deployment version became apparent after a village in Maywar had been seized by enemy forces, with the only viable option for cover being an old shipping port, although the gap for vehicle crossing was too small for large vehicles to cross without risking the loss of valuable supplies.

At the same time, Squirrel Industries needed a vehicle to cross the port that was capable of carrying soldiers and VIPs to the area without putting them in harms way. Thus the Iris variant was required.

As a result of the combined effort of Apollo, Ares, Athena, Hermes and Iris, the village was taken back under control and the enemy threat neutralised. While aircraft could have achieved a similar goal, it wouldn't have been without much more destruction to the area. As a result, Squirrel Industries is looking to invest more in ground vehicles, while also making advancements in aircraft design.
